Leonard Vicari is a painter, actor and video maker. Born in Paris on May 24
1993, he moved to impressionist lands at the age of 3, in Rouen, where he grew up in
an open framework and education, influenced by art and work, raised by
restaurant parents.
All the summers of his youth he spent in Sicily,
with his paternal family, who also lull him with their stories. A rear
grandfather general of the army, uncles painters, writers, a grandmother
woman of the world, poet…
All this influences it naturally and from the most
At a young age he grabs the pencils and won't let go, he knows full well that
his life will be made of pictorial art. He had a vision of it. At a very young age he learned to
draw by reproducing his hand, then the drawings of his comics, he discovers the
painters, the great Masters.
By entering the National School of Architecture of Normandy, he discovered the different
movements that have marked the history of art. He also learned graffiti
thanks to his cousin Romain Vicari, Italian-Brazilian visual artist and begins
to paint the walls of the city, in the carefreeness and joys of youth. He
then begins his first paintings and discovers a theme
personal, which will accompany him until today': dreamlike. Dreams
very quickly became his main source of inspiration.
The dream like
experience, the dream as sensation, the dream as light of reality. After
having moved to Montpellier, then to Belgium, he now lives in Paris and
Menton, where he works and experiments with his graphic art, always borrowing from a
dialogue between the dream world and the real world.
